RECHARGEABLE BATTERIES HAVING A SPECIFIC ANODE AND PROCESS FOR THE PRODUCTION OF THEM

    Applicant: CANON KK

    Abstract: A highly reliable rechargeable battery comprising an anode, a cathode, a separator positioned between said anode and said cathode, and an electrolyte or an electrolyte solution disposed so as to contact with said anode and said cathode, wherein said anode comprises an electrically conductive material, and said electrically conductive material is provided with an insulating or semiconductor film such that at least protrusions present at said electrically conductive material are covered by said insulating or semiconductor film while forming an opening between adjacent protrusions such that said opening is communicated with said electrically conductive material of said anode and said electrically conductive material of said anode contacts with said electrolyte or said electrolyte solution through said opening. The rechargeable battery is of an increased capacity and it provides an increased energy density and has a prolonged charging and discharging cycle life, in which the generation or growth of a dendrite of lithium or zinc is effectively prevented.

    METHOD OF PRODUCING A RECHARGEABLE LITHIUM BATTERY HAVING AN IMPROVED CATHODE

    Applicant: CANON KK

    Abstract: A rechargeable lithium battery comprising at least a cathode, a separator, an anode, and an electrolyte or electrolyte solution integrated in a battery housing, characterized in that said cathode is constituted by a specific powdery cathode active material having a large specific surface area and a primary particle size of 0.5 .mu.m or less. The cathode active material is obtained in a manner of mixing a salt of a transition metal in and dissolving said salt in an aqueous solution containing at least a water-soluble polymer material to obtain a product, and baking said product to form said powdery cathode active material as said cathode active material of said cathode, or in another manner of mixing a salt of a transition metal in a monomer capable of forming at least a water-soluble polymer material, polymerizing said monomer to obtain a polymerized product, and baking said polymerized product to form a said powdery cathode active material as said cathode active material of said cathode. A process for the production of said rechargeable lithium battery.
